In the valleys and mountains of Wales, especially in the Snowdon National Park, the steam railway has been part of the landscape for more than a century. Here we see pretty little engines and beautiful great mountains. Using materials hewn from the rock, these railways have truly changed the landscape forever. The steam locomotives and the trains themselves have great charm and they are amongst the most beautiful of man’s creations, set amidst some of nature’s finest landscapes.

Did the railway change Scotland or did Scotland change the railway? Whatever the answer, Scotland’s railways have always had a unique character, and were used to bring industry to its cities and civilisation to its extremities. Little stations and single-track lines shape the mountains and some of the most beautiful locomotive liveries of all time had their origins in the Kingdom's Glens and Lochs.

 

This classic re-issue of footage from a book and DVD package contains superb film of steam locomotives at work - from over three decades past - in the landscapes that they helped to create …and is a stunning reminder of the lasting Beauty of Steam.
